Feature Comparison
| Feature | GPT-5.5 | Grok 4.1 Fast |
|---|---|---|
| Provider | OpenAI | xAI |
| Input Price | $5.00/1M tokens | $0.20/1M tokens |
| Output Price | $30.00/1M tokens | $0.50/1M tokens |
| Context Window | 1,050,000 tokens | 2,000,000 tokens |
| Max Output | 128,000 tokens | 131,072 tokens |
| Category | flagship | efficient |
| Capabilities | textvisioncodereasoning | textreasoningcode |
| Release Date | 4/24/2026 | 1/15/2026 |
GPT-5.5 vs Grok 4.1 Fast: Which Should You Choose?
Choosing between GPT-5.5 and Grok 4.1 Fast depends on your priorities: cost efficiency, context length, or raw capability. Grok 4.1 Fast is the more affordable option at $0.20/1M input tokens — 96% cheaper than GPT-5.5. Meanwhile, Grok 4.1 Fast offers a significantly larger context window at 2,000,000 tokens vs 1,050,000 for GPT-5.5.
These models come from different providers — OpenAI and xAI — which means different API ecosystems, SDKs, rate limits, and terms of service. If you're already integrated with OpenAI, switching to xAIinvolves migration effort beyond just pricing. Factor in your existing infrastructure when deciding.
These models target different tiers: GPT-5.5 is a flagship model while Grok 4.1 Fast is efficient. This means they're optimized for different workloads. GPT-5.5 is built for complex tasks that require deeper reasoning, while Grok 4.1 Fast offers better value for routine operations.
Output costs matter too. GPT-5.5 charges $30.00/1M output tokens vs $0.50 for Grok 4.1 Fast. For generation-heavy workloads (content creation, code generation, summarization), output pricing often dominates your bill. Grok 4.1 Fast has the edge here at $0.50/1M output tokens.
Multimodal capabilities: GPT-5.5 supports vision (image inputs) while Grok 4.1 Fast is text-only. If your application needs image understanding, this narrows your choice.
